Tara Brach: Trusting Who We Are [2019-11-06]
When we are suffering, we are believing something untrue - usually a limiting story about who we are. This talk explores the roots of our self-doubts, and the teachings and practices that remind us of our basic goodness - the loving awareness that is our source.
This talk was given at the Fall 2019 IMCW 7-Day Silent Retreat.
